[h3]In this update, we focused on optimizing the gameplay experience after a thorough analysis over player feedback by introducing new features to further expand the experience. Here's an overview over the main changes:[/h3] [b]Settings improvements:[/b] [list] [*]Commands are now automatically adjusted according to the language of your steam account, offering a more intuitive experience for players using different keyboard layouts (AZERTY for French and QWERTY for English). [*]We've enhanced the settings interface to highlight the ability to change commands, offering players improved accessibility. [/list] [b]Gameplay improvements:[/b] [list] [*]Projectiles are now removed and the player benefits from a brief period of invincibility when reappearing, avoiding unfair situations after death. []Trappers will no longer get stuck in their own bombs, ensuring smooth gameplay. [*]Boss animations can now be skipped for faster progression through the game (space bar). [*]The Butcher will no longer cause contact damage after his death. [/list] [b]Gameplay modification:[/b] [list] [*]The patterns of certain bosses (meatmud and butcher) have been adapted, to make combat more dynamic and less predictable. [*]Trappers have had their behavior revisited: they now chase toward the player to drop bombs near him. [/list] [b]Visual and sound improvements:[/b] [list] [*]A thicker, more colorful border has been added to shots, improving the understanding and aesthetics of fights. [*]Adjustments have been made to resolve visual issues such as red shots appearing when the bar is empty. [*]New sound effects, including a distinctive noise for Skullburn teleportation, have been integrated for added immersion. [/list] [b]Optimized progression and user interface:[/b] [list] [*]The speed of falling and picking up gems has been increased, making item collection smoother and more enjoyable. [*]Inventory collisions for item interaction have been fixed, ensuring a smooth experience when using inventory features. [/list] [b]Miscellaneous:[/b] [list] [*]Fixed a bug not displaying the taskbar icon. [*]Fixed a bug on the GIGA-CHAD achievement that was obtained upon entering the boss room. [*]Game stability improvements.
